## Changelog 4.2.0 — Encoding detection defaults changed

The Textwell ingest service no longer assumes UTF-8 for uploaded text files. Detection now runs a confidence-scored pass over the first 64 KB, rejecting files below threshold instead of silently transcoding. This closes the mojibake-based smuggling vector raised in last quarter's review. Fallback charsets were also narrowed. The new default detection settings shipped with this release are listed below.

config for kafof-bawef:
holath:
  log_level: debug
  metrics_host: metrics.holath.qorvelsys.internal
  pin: 2191
  pool_size: 32

Hi Mira,

Quick heads-up for the Q3 DR drill. We're failing over Widespan — the big-file diff viewer — to the Corveth standby cluster on Thursday morning. Expect the render workers to lag for ~20 minutes while the cache warms. One snag: the standby's secrets store was rebuilt last month, so the automated unseal won't work. You'll need to unseal manually as release manager. The recovery passphrase you should use is on the next line.

Thanks,
Ott

strongbox words: zoreth-fraox-oliius-aldeth-jorax-praeth-holmir-drumir-prawyn

## Cold Storage Archiving

Buckets in the Frostvale tier are archived by the `glacier-sweep` job every Sunday at 02:00 UTC. Objects untouched for 180 days move to the Permafrost store; the manifest table tracks each transition. If the sweep stalls, check the archiver pod logs before retrying. To verify manifest rows directly, connect to the archive metadata database using the connection string below.

replica DSN, tawef-hahap: mysql://eliix_svc:FiIC0jz@db-394a.lumiclabs.internal:5432/holius

**Q: Why is my parcel-tracking webhook not firing?**

Cartographe only dispatches webhooks after a carrier-confirmed scan event, so label creation alone won't trigger one. Verify your endpoint returns a 2xx within five seconds; slower responses are retried three times, then suspended. You can replay suspended deliveries from the plugin console. If deliveries remain stuck after a replay, write to us at the address below.

escalation mailbox, hadug-bajog: sormir@norvalabs.internal